Overview of Denmark Cashier Jobs with Visa Sponsorship 2026
As a cashier, you will be a key part of running a store. You will handle customer transactions, help them, and make sure the checkout process runs well. In retail or service contexts, you will also oversee the swift handling of transactions and ensure excellent customer service.

General Duties of Denmark Cashier Jobs with Visa Sponsorship 2026
- First and foremost, you will scan items and take payments.
- Second, you will handle returns and exchanges and provide receipts to customers.
- Third, you will support customers with queries and information about the products.
- You will also ensure that the checkout area is neat and clean.
- Additionally, you will check the balances of the cash registers.
- You will also restock shelves and help with inventory when needed.
- Lastly, you will provide consumers with pleasant and professional service.
